Ansible role to perform an initial code deploy to a UCLA Library Blacklight system using Capistrano
This role handles the first deployment of Blacklight project code from a git repository to the rails application server.
Please take note of the following assumptions:
- the rails application server uses Red Hat Enterprise Linux 7 for the OS
- a Solr 7.X server is available with the index core created and project-specific configuration files installed in the core
- a MySQL database server is available with the project-specific database created and user account/privileges established
- a git repository is available containing the project's code
- project-specific variables for this role can be defined in a vars file with a name following the format of
projectname_envname.yml
- an example vars file is available in
vars/exampleproj_test.yml
- this vars file will contain sensitive information and should be encrypted with ansible-vault
- NOTE: if you choose not to use the vars file for including the variable definitions, they should be defined in the playbook file

The uclalib_role_blacklight_capdeploy
role can also be used to build a developers' box that mimics the environment used in production. To do this, slight changes are needed in the way that the role is run. The need for these changes is a result of having tagged tasks in the ansible_user_env_setup.yml
, capistrano_deploy.yml
, and dotenv_setup.yml
files, which are specific to a developers' box build. These are ignored for production builds.
To trigger the running of tasks that are only needed for a developers' box, supply the following two arguments when you run your Ansible playbook:
--skip-tags "always" --tags "untagged,development"
For a production build, you would omit these arguments and the tasks that are intended only for the developers' box would be, by default, skipped.
Running the build with the above skip-tags
and tags
arguments ensures that the project .env files for a developers' box are created, that the test database is created, and that the GitHub source is kept on the machine for the developer to use.
